Gas Tankless Water Heaters operate on an on-demand principle, heating water only when required thereby eliminating the need for extended storage and consequent standby losses. These heaters high thermal efficiency, compact design, and longer lifespan compared to their traditional counterparts are features that have enhanced their adoption significantly. Major applications span across residential, commercial and industrial sectors, with the residential segment accounting for a lions share due to increasing consumer emphasis on energy efficiency and green building practices.

Applications of Gas Tankless Water Heaters in Residential, Commercial & Industrial
Gas tankless water heaters are ideal solutions for residential spaces due to their compact design and energy-efficient properties. They are primarily used to provide instant hot water on demand, eliminating the waiting time and energy wastage of traditional storage water heaters. Residential models, offered by leading market players such as Rheem and Rinnai, deliver unparalleled continuous hot water supply, making them a perfect choice for large households.
These heaters are also increasingly being recognized for their capacity to support commercial operations such as hotels, restaurants, and office buildings. High-capacity gas tankless water heaters, like those developed by Navien, can address the high-demand hot water requirements of these venues. Their major advantage is they provide a steady hot water supply, even amidst peak usage times, thus ensuring consistent service to customers and enhancing overall operational efficiency.
On the industrial front, gas tankless water heaters find applications in industries such as manufacturing, pharmaceuticals, and food processing where a large volume of hot water is routinely required. Heaters from companies such as Bosch and Noritz are renowned for their durability, high output, and consistency, able to meet the rigorous demands of industrial usage. The systems significant energy saving features also contribute to cost and resource management, strengthening economic and environmental sustainability.
